Up for sale and just acquired is this authentic early auto pistol made by Smith & Wesson. The Smith & Wesson Model 39?2 was produced from 1971 to 1983. It is a 9mm, double?action/single?action, semi?automatic pistol built as an improved version of the original Model 39. It features an aluminum?alloy frame, 8?round magazine, 4-inch barrel, and a slide?mounted safety/decocker.
The original Model 39 was the first U.S.-made DA/SA 9mm pistol, developed after WWII for potential military adoption. The 39?2 variant entered production in 1971, incorporating reliability improvements based on user feedback. Production continued until 1983, after which S&W moved toward higher?capacity designs like the Model 59 and later 2nd?generation pistols.
The 39?2 became popular with law enforcement during the 1970s as agencies began transitioning from revolvers to semi?automatic pistols.
